All bees and bee products, including used appliances, require a Form 3 Health Certificate to enter South Australia. This is a national certificate suitable for entry into other states.
The small hive beetle (SHB) is a notifiable disease that has been detected in Victoria.
To delay the introduction of SHB from Victoria into South Australia there are entry requirements in place for apiarists returning from Victoria.

Kangaroo Island is a sanctuary for Ligurian bees.
No bees or second hand bee hives or any other equipment may be introduced to the Island. Apairy products are also restricted from entry to Kangaroo Island unless tested and verified to be free of disease. This must be certified by an apiary inspector.
Kangaroo Island is currently free of American Foulbrood, European Foulbrood and Chalkbrood.
